2011-07-04 11 views
5

Aquí hay un poco de código que funciona bien en los teléfonos:sin intención de ver jpg en honeycomb?

Intent intent = new Intent(); 
intent.setAction(Intent.ACTION_VIEW); 
intent.setDataAndType(IMAGEURI, "image/jpg"); 
startActivity(intent); 

que por Honeycomb (3.0 y 3.1) tiros esto:

E/AndroidRuntime(25629): FATAL EXCEPTION: main 
E/AndroidRuntime(25629): android.content.ActivityNotFoundException: No Activity found to handle Intent { act=android.intent.action.VIEW dat=content://media/external/images/media/282 typ=image/jpg } 

serio? No hay una aplicación para ver jpg en honeycomb? De Verdad? ¿Alguien ha podido hacer esto correctamente en una tableta?

Respuesta

7

El tipo MIME para JPEG es image/jpeg. Usted tiene image/jpg.

+0

Gracias! imagen/jpg funcionó bien en teléfonos. image/jpeg funciona en teléfonos y tabletas. – anakin78z

Cuestiones relacionadas